Day 1: Arrival and Welcome in Marrakech

We welcome you at Marrakech Menara Airport and provide a comfortable transfer to your traditional riad in the Medina. Depending on your arrival time, you may relax or begin exploring. In the afternoon, we guide you through the heart of the old city. 

You visit Jemaa el-Fnaa square, a place filled with storytellers, local food, and music. We also take you to see the Koutoubia Mosque and the Bahia Palace. These sites show the charm of Moroccan culture. You enjoy dinner at the riad and rest well to begin your 5 Days in Morocco tour.

Driving distance: Approximately 6 km
Driving time: Approximately 15 min

Day 2: Marrakech to Dades Valley via Ait Ben Haddou and Ouarzazate

Your Marrakech to Dades desert tour begins with an 8:00 AM hotel/riad pick-up in Marrakech. We head southeast, crossing the High Atlas mountains with amazing views of Berber villages. On the way, we stop for photos and rest breaks.

Lunch is served in the Kasbah Ait Ben Haddou, where you visit the famous UNESCO World Heritage Site, Ait Ben Haddou Kasbah. This site has appeared in many movies like Gladiator and Lawrence of Arabia. You explore the kasbah and learn its history.

We continue to Ouarzazate and stop at the entrance of Atlas Studios, the largest film studio in Africa. You may choose to take an inside tour. From there, we drive through the Valley of Roses and reach Dades Valley. You may visit the famous “monkey fingers” rock formations or explore them the next morning. We check in to your hotel or riad for the night.

Driving distance: Approximately 353 km
Driving time: Approximately 6 hr 30 min

Day 3: Dades Valley to Merzouga Desert

After breakfast, we start our journey to the Sahara Desert. We drive through Tinghir and stop at Todgha Gorge, where you can take a short walk along the river surrounded by high rock walls. This is a perfect place for photos and enjoying nature.

We continue through the Ziz Valley and small Berber towns. Around mid-afternoon, we reach Merzouga, where your camel caravan awaits. You ride through the sand dunes of Erg Chebbi, the highlight of your 5 Days in Morocco tour. As the sun sets, you arrive at your desert camp.

Dinner is served under the stars, followed by local music around the fire. You sleep in a traditional tent, enjoying the silence of the desert.

Driving distance: Approximately 270 km
Driving time: Approximately 5 hr 30 min

Day 4: Merzouga to Fes

We wake up early so you can watch the sunrise over the dunes. After breakfast at the camp, you ride your camel back to Merzouga. From there, we drive north through the Ziz Valley, passing palm groves and local villages. We stop for lunch in Midelt.

Our journey continues through the Middle Atlas Mountains, where you may see Barbary monkeys near Azrou. We pass through Ifrane, known as the “Switzerland of Morocco,” before reaching Fes in the evening. We check you into your riad and enjoy a quiet evening in this ancient city.

Driving distance: Approximately 467 km
Driving time: Approximately 8 hr

Day 5: Explore Fes and Departure

After breakfast, we guide you through the oldest part of Fes, Fes el-Bali. You visit traditional markets, old tanneries, and the world’s oldest university, Al-Qarawiyyin. The narrow streets and old buildings will take you back in time.

Depending on your flight or travel plans, we offer a transfer to Fes airport or help you return to Marrakech. This marks the end of your 5 Days in Morocco tour.
